Call Our Workplace Directly For More Options Skin tag removal methods consist of excision, cryosurgery, cauterization, and ligation. Excision merely refers to cutting away the skin tag with a scalpel or special scissors. Cryosurgery is a. fancy way of saying "freezing," and Lipo Freeze 2U Nottingham – HIFU and More is also frequently made use of to eliminate protuberances. With cauterization, the skin tag is burned away via electrical current. And ligation is a process through which blood is cut off from the skin tag so it ultimately diminishes (sort of like a scab). Fat Cell Augmentation Is An Independent Marker Of Insulin Resistance And Hyperleptinaemia Diabetologia Springer Nature Link Hence, adiponectin has a vital role in skeletal muscle mass metabolic rate in human beings in addition to rats, and defective adiponectin signaling in skeletal muscle mass might contribute to insulin resistance. People with diabetes mellitus had bigger fat cells than the healthy controls yet stromal cell populace frequencies, adipose lipolysis and secretion of inflammatory proteins did not differ in between the two teams. Nevertheless, in the whole cohort fat cell size associated favorably with the proportion of M1/M2 macrophages, TNF-α secretion, lipolysis and insulin resistance. Expression of genetics inscribing regulatory authorities of adipogenesis and adipose morphology (BMP4, CEBPα [likewise called CEBPA], PPARγ [additionally referred to as PPARG] and EBF1) correlated adversely with fat cell dimension. The CNIC study highlights the essential function of the caveolae protein caveolin-1 (Cav-1). For caveolae to squash appropriately in response to changes in mechanical tension in the cell membrane, Cav-1 needs to be chemically altered by the enhancement of a phosphoryl team to a specific amino acid, a procedure called phosphorylation. For the research study, the scientists established a transgenic mouse that expresses a genetically modified variation of Cav-1 that can not be phosphorylated. This renders adipocytes unable to increase correctly in action to the mechanical tension produced by the build-up of lipids (see number), significantly restricting their capacity to keep power and keep cellular honesty. While the induction of adipogenesis is differentially controlled by different thyroid hormonal agent receptor (TR) isoforms, researches mostly indicate that TRs promote adipogenesis most of version systems (245 ). When an adipocyte collects fat and its surface area is under increased tensile anxiety, the caveolae squash, launching a 'storage tank' of membrane that enables the cell to increase the size of without breaking apart. On the other hand, when fat gets decrease, these frameworks collect yourself to minimize the excess membrane and recover mobile security." A. CoolSculpting is the trade name for cryolipolysis, which is a therapy that utilizes cold temperatures to ruin fat cells while staying clear of frostbite to the overlapping skin. It is based upon a discovery that fat cells can be harmed by cooling it to temperature levels that do not hurt bordering skin, nerves, capillary, or muscle mass tissue.
